Family tree:
Animalia (Kingdom) > Mollusca (Phylum) > Gastropoda (Class) > Neogastropoda (Order) > Mangeliidae (Family) > Smithiella (Genus) > costulata (Species) 
Initial determination:
(Risso, ), 1826 
Occurrence:
Tunesien, Algeria, Balearic Islands, Belgium, Egypt, European Coasts, France, Italy, Madeira, Marmara Sea ( Sea of Marmara), North Atlantic Ocean, Spain, The Aegan Sea (Mediterranean), the Canary Islands, the Mediterranean Sea, Turkey 
Marine Zone:
Subtidal, sublittoral, infralittoral, deep zone of the oceans from the lower limit of the intertidal zone (intertidal) to the shelf edge at about 200 m water depth. neritic. 
Sea depth:
80 - 150 Meter 
Habitats:
Muddy grounds, Seagrass meadows, Eelgrass Meadows 
Size:
0" - 0.39" (0,8cm - 1,5cm) 
Temperature:
°F - 78.8 °F (°C - 26°C) 
Food:
Carnivore, Invertebrates, Predatory, Zoobenthos

Smithiella costulata (Risso, 1826)

Synonymised names
Bela (Smithiella) costulata (Risso, 1826) · unaccepted > superseded combination
Bela costulata (Risso, 1826) · unaccepted
Bela costulata scacchii F. Nordsieck, 1972 · unaccepted > junior subjective synonym (synonym)
Bela ornata (Locard, 1891) · unaccepted > junior objective synonym
Mangelia costulata Risso, 1826 · unaccepted
Mangelia smithii (Forbes, 1840) · unaccepted
Mangelia wareni Piani, 1980 · unaccepted
Pleurotoma costulata (Risso, 1826) · unaccepted (superseded generic combination)
Pleurotoma farrani W. Thompson, 1845 · unaccepted (synonym)
Pleurotoma loeviana Reeve, 1845 · unaccepted (original combination)
Pleurotoma smithii Forbes, 1840 · unaccepted (original combination)
Pleurotoma striolatum (Risso, 1826) sensu Scacchi, 1836 · unaccepted (misapplication)
Raphitoma (Smithiella) costulatum (Risso, 1826) · unaccepted > superseded combination
Raphitoma exstriolata Cerulli-Irelli, 1910 · unaccepted > junior subjective synonym
Raphitoma ornata Locard, 1891 · unaccepted > junior objective synonym
Raphitoma rissoi Locard, 1886 · unaccepted > junior objective synonym (unnecessary replacement name for...)
Raphitoma strictum Locard, 1891 · unaccepted
Smithia striolata Monterosato, 1884 · unaccepted (synonym)
Smithiella loeviana (Reeve, 1845) · unaccepted
Smithiella striolata (Monterosato, 1884) · unaccepted

Direct children (1)
Subspecies Smithiella costulata intermedia Nordsieck, 1977 (uncertain > unassessed)
